Plain-language summary

Transfers the AJCCC to the DCAA as an organisational unit, including its duties, functions, and assets under UAE legislation, effective upon publication.

    Law No. (8) of 2020 Transferring Al Jalila Cultural Centre for Children to the Dubai Culture and Arts Authority Page 2 of 3 Transfer and Succession

  2. 2

    Article 2

    Article (2) a. The following is hereby transferred to the DCAA: 1. the duties and functions assigned to the AJCCC under the above-mentioned Law No. (9) of 2013 and the legislation in force in the Emirate; 2. the ownership of the real property, movables, assets, devices, equipment, and other property of the AJCCC; 3. the employees of the AJCCC. They will be governed by the above-mentioned Law No. (8) of 2018 and will retain their existing rights; and 4. the financial appropriations allocated to the AJCCC in its annual budget. b. All rights and obligations of the AJCCC are hereby transferred to the DCAA. Issuing Implementing Resolutions

    Article (3) The Chairman of the Executive Council will issue the resolutions required for the implementation of the provisions of this Law. Repeals

  4. 4

    Article 4

    Article (4) a. The above-mentioned Law No. (9) of 2013 and its amendments and Decree No. (31) of 2013 are hereby repealed. b. Any provision in any other legislation will be repealed to the extent that it contradicts the provisions of this Law. c. The bylaws, regulations, and resolutions issued in implementation of the above-mentioned Law No. (9) of 2013 will continue in force to the extent that they do not contradict this Law and the regulations, resolutions, and bylaws relevant to the DCAA, until new superseding bylaws, regulations, and resolutions are issued.
